- The distance between Vilsandi, Estonia and Port Sudan, Sudan is approximately 4,492 km or 2,791 mi.
- To reach Vilsandi in this distance one would set out from Port Sudan bearing 347.6° or NNW and follow the great circles arc to approach Vilsandi bearing 337.3° or NNW .
- Vilsandi has a warm summer continental/ hemiboreal climate with no dry season (Dfb) whereas Port Sudan has a subtropical hot desert climate (BWh).
- The average annual temperature is 22 °C (39.6°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 8 °C (14.4°F) more in Vilsandi. The continentality subtype is semicontinental as opposed to truly oce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 504.9 mm (19.9 in) more which is equivalent to 504.9 l/m² (12.39 US gal/ft²) or 5,049,000 l/ha (539,772 US gal/ac) more. About 7 5/8 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 37.6° lower in Vilsandi than in Port Sudan.
